Merge pull request #806 from creative-commoners/pulls/5.2/localise-step-nav

FIX Step navigation buttons are not translatable
This commit is contained in:
Dylan Wagstaff 2018-09-04 21:06:23 +12:00 committed by GitHub
commit 9b48b4f954
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
2 changed files with 9 additions and 3 deletions

View File

@ -147,6 +147,8 @@ en:
one: 'A Page Break' one: 'A Page Break'
other: '{count} Page Breaks' other: '{count} Page Breaks'
SINGULARNAME: 'Page Break' SINGULARNAME: 'Page Break'
STEP_NEXT: Next
STEP_PREV: Prev
STEP_TITLE: 'Page {page}' STEP_TITLE: 'Page {page}'
TITLE_FIRST: 'First Page' TITLE_FIRST: 'First Page'
SilverStripe\UserForms\Model\EditableFormField\EditableLiteralField: SilverStripe\UserForms\Model\EditableFormField\EditableLiteralField:

View File

@ -5,10 +5,14 @@
so the 'prev' and 'next' button are not used. These buttons are made visible via JavaScript. so the 'prev' and 'next' button are not used. These buttons are made visible via JavaScript.
--%> --%>
<li class="step-button-wrapper" aria-hidden="true" style="display:none;"> <li class="step-button-wrapper" aria-hidden="true" style="display:none;">
<button class="step-button-prev">Prev</button> <button class="step-button-prev">
<%t SilverStripe\\UserForms\\Model\\EditableFormField\\EditableFormStep.STEP_PREV "Prev" %>
</button>
</li> </li>
<li class="step-button-wrapper" aria-hidden="true" style="display:none;"> <li class="step-button-wrapper" aria-hidden="true" style="display:none;">
<button class="step-button-next">Next</button> <button class="step-button-next">
<%t SilverStripe\\UserForms\\Model\\EditableFormField\\EditableFormStep.STEP_NEXT "Next" %>
</button>
</li> </li>
<% if $Actions %> <% if $Actions %>
@ -20,4 +24,4 @@
<% end_if %> <% end_if %>
</ul> </ul>
</nav> </nav>